Abstract
A simple discrimination technique for detection and identification of individual gases/odours using a polar plot based on response of an int egrated sensor array is presented. The responses of an array of eight integrated sensors are used to generate the desired pattern. The requi red pattern is generated by taking the normalized response of the sens ors (normalization with reference to the response of the first sensor) . For the identification of gases/odours, the data set is generated by taking the opposite angle of adjacent sensors in training mode and co mparing with the data set obtained in the sniffing mode. The suggested method has been validated using experimental data for butanol, methan ol and propanol. (C) 1996 Elsevier Science Ltd.
